Transaction 0090a070e58cd062d3c938cdcb6a3b552e10be1e6991dba1507182c11332ca9f

1 Input
2 Outputs
  • 0090a070e58cd062d3c938cdcb6a3b552e10be1e6991dba1507182c11332ca9f:0
  • value  582942
    address  3P87LzwPiYX17JgZAXPdkR25vWVpDYPCvP
  • 0090a070e58cd062d3c938cdcb6a3b552e10be1e6991dba1507182c11332ca9f:1
  • value  119000000
    address  3QjuwymDYu1RxGeKL4JeVikYZLLcVrueNt